Software Engineer
Locations: Columbia, MD; Augusta, GA
The Swift Group is a privately held, mission-driven and employee-focused services and solutions company headquartered in Reston, VA. Our capabilities include Software Development, Engineering & IT, Data Science, Cyber Enablement, Logistics, and Training. Founded in 2019, Swift supports Civilian, Defense, and Intelligence Community customers across the country and around the globe.
We are looking for a Software Engineer to join our high-performing team on a dynamic program. The ideal candidate thrives in a modern development environment, brings a deep understanding of Java-based systems, and is comfortable working across the full software lifecycle. They will contribute to the design, development, and delivery of robust software solutions and will work on complex systems that leverage microservices architectures, RESTful APIs, and cloud-native technologies.
Responsibilities:
- Design, develop, and maintain scalable Java-based applications using modern frameworks such as Spring
- Collaborate with cross-functional teams to develop and integrate RESTful web services and microservices solutions
- Troubleshoot and resolve issues in complex distributed systems
- Participate in all phases of the software development lifecycle including planning, development, testing, and deployment
- Contribute to Agile development activities including daily standups, sprint planning, and more
- Develop and maintain software documentation and configuration using tools like Git, Maven, and Nexus
Requirements:
- Bachelor’s degree in Computer Science or related field
- Mid-level candidates: 3-8 years of relevant experience
- Senior-level candidates: 9-13 years of relevant experience
- SME-level candidates: 14+ years of relevant experience
- Proficient in Java and modern Java libraries/frameworks (e.g., Spring, Guava)
- Strong experience with RESTful web services, microservices architecture, and enterprise API design
- Solid understanding of Object-Oriented Programming (OOP) principles
- Experience developing in Linux-based environments
- Familiarity with configuration and build tools such as Git, Maven, and Nexus
- Working knowledge of Agile methodologies and associated toolsets (e.g., JIRA, Confluence)
- Must have a DoD 8140 / 8570 compliance certification (e.g. Security+)
- Must be able to work in a hybrid environment, spending an average of 1-2 days per week at our office. However, flexibility is essential to accommodate any changes in the schedule
- US citizenship and an active Secret clearance; will accept higher clearance such as Top Secret, TS/SCI, and/or TS/SCI with CI Polygraph
Desired Experience:
- Experience with distributed data platforms and streaming tools (e.g., NiFi, Kafka) –
- Hands-on experience with cloud platforms such as AWS or Azure
- Familiarity with containerization and orchestration (e.g., Docker, Kubernetes)
- Experience with NoSQL databases and full-text search engines (e.g., MongoDB, Elasticsearch, Solr) –
- Scripting proficiency (e.g., Python, Bash)
- Exposure to Big Data platforms and secure data processing architectures
#LI-DI1
#OnsiteThe Swift Group and Subsidiaries are an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or veteran status, or any other protected class.
Pay Range: $49,996.80 - $290,004.00
Pay ranges are a general guideline and not intended as a guaranteed and/or implied final compensation or salary for this job opening. Determination of official compensation or salary relies on several different factors including, but not limited to: level of position, complexity of job responsibilities, geographic location, work experience, education, certifications, Federal Government contract labor categories, and contract wage rates.
At The Swift Group and Subsidiaries, you will receive comprehensive benefits including but not limited to: healthcare, wellness, financial, retirement, education, and time off benefits.
Recommended Jobs
Data Engineer I
When you join the team at Unum, you become part of an organization committed to helping you thrive. Here, we work to provide the employee benefits and service solutions that enable employees at our cl…
Sous Chef
Our restaurant is searching for a creative and motivated sous chef to join our talented kitchen team. In this position, you will act as the second in command in our kitchen, following and enforcing o…
AGM / KM | Conyers, GA
We are seeking a highly skilled and motivated Assistant General Manager to help lead the team at a fun and growing Casual Dining restaurant. As an Assistant General Manager, you will assist in overse…
Electrician with Wiring Solutions, Inc.
We are looking for individuals who will help us grow into something bigger; with your help, we believe we can achieve that. We need individuals that are energetic, hardworking, current on the NEC Cod…
RN Homecare - All Shifts
Est. pay- $25-$32 per hour (case by case specific) Sign on bonus: $1,200 FT Day Shift, $1750 FT Night Shifts Maxim Healthcare in Cleveland is hiring for a Registered Nurse to work with Pediatric…
Customer Data Object Owner
Responsibilities Accountable for the definition and maintenance of customer master data objects within the SAP S/4 system, ensuring alignment with business requirements and data governance standards. …
Sourcing Manager - IT Supply Chain
How you'll help us Keep Climbing (overview & key responsibilities) The Strategic Sourcing Manager - IT Supply Chain is responsible for sourcing and negotiating key products and services utilized by De…
Bookkeeper - Sandy Springs (Perimeter)
Bookkeeper - Sandy Springs (Perimeter) Who: A strong, stable company with nearly 20 years in business is hiring a dependable Bookkeeper due to continued growth. What: You will oversee daily fina…
Chiropractic Assistant
Wanted: Chiropractic Assistant to serve at our Savannah Area Clinics Are you a compassionate and dedicated office or chiropractic assistant that's passionate about helping others feel their bes…
Senior Growth Marketing Manager
Are you great at growing a company’s brand footprint and client base through paid ad strategies? Prefer working for a company where every employee is an owner? Love to collaborate with fun, creative …